Gothic-Baroque Church of the Nativity of Virgin Mary (Kostel Narození Panny Marie), filial church of Roman Catholic parish in Kralupy nad Vltavou, is principal landmark of village Nová Ves-Veprek.
The core of the Church of the Nativity of Virgin Mary was erected probably as early as in the 13th century, but the first recorded date is 1352. Originally Gothic parish church was extended and rebuilt in the Baroque style in 1684-1697. Further smaller changes and reconstructions were done in years 1752, 1892, 1902 a 1907. The last reconstruction together with detailed archeological and structural survey was finished in 2004.
Church is single nave rectangular structure with transversally laid nave. On the eastern side is extended by rectangular space enclosed by triagonal presbytery. Polygonal presbytery is atoped by sanctus turret. Interior (altars, pulpit, confessional, baptismal font and pews) is Baroque. Church is surrounded by cemetery enclosed by wall.
